Using the scale below, circle ONE number for each person on your team/group (excluding yourself) to indicate his or her overall contribution to the team.

9 = consistently went above and beyond—supported teammates, carried more than

his /her fair share of the load, always well-prepared, very cooperative.

8 = consistently did what he/she was supposed to do, usually well-prepared and

cooperative

7 = usually did what he/she was supposed to do, acceptably prepared and

cooperative

6 = Often did what he/she was supposed to do, minimally prepared and cooperative

5 = Sometimes did what he/she was supposed to do, minimally prepared and cooperative

4 = Sometimes failed to show up or complete assignments, rarely prepared

3 = Often failed to show up or complete assignments, rarely prepared

2 = consistently failed to show up or complete assignments, rarely prepared

1 = practically no participation

0 = No participation at all
